I did figure out what was causing the install USB device sound with the Logitech G400s. It's a minor bug in the driver, that makes the install hardware sound when it puts the icon in the taskbar upon waking or cold boot. If you change the mouse's icon to "only show notifications" it stops doing it.

I like a G400s I'm playing with. It has programmable buttons and profiles. I set one profile up to use one button for toggling the map open and closed, and like the DPI customization. I set the DPI memory for TS2013 at 1000, 1200, 1400, 1600 and 1800 with the default at 1200 when the program starts. That makes driving engines in the HUD easier, since some have those split throttles and/or brakes that are kind of sensitive. I can turn it down or up depending on engine.
The 1800 dpi setting is only useful when in the editor "landscaping"
